Have you ever wondered how your smart home devices communicate seamlessly with each other? It’s fascinating how your lights, thermostat, security cameras, and voice assistants work together to create a smooth, integrated experience. At the core of this harmony are smart home protocols—sets of rules that enable different devices to understand and interact with one another. But achieving this seamless integration isn’t always straightforward. You face interoperability challenges, where incompatible devices or protocols can hinder communication. For example, a Zigbee-enabled light bulb might not easily connect with a Z-Wave-based security system, forcing you to juggle multiple hubs or apps. Overcoming these hurdles requires careful planning and choosing compatible devices or smart hubs that support multiple protocols. Without proper interoperability, your smart home can become fragmented, reducing the convenience you seek. Security considerations are equally essential when multiple devices communicate across various protocols. Each protocol introduces potential vulnerabilities, especially if not properly secured. When devices transmit sensitive data—like camera feeds or personal schedules—it’s imperative that the communication remains encrypted and protected from hacking. Some protocols have advanced security features built in, while others may pose risks if left unsecured. As you expand your smart home, you need to be vigilant about updating firmware and using strong, unique passwords for each device. Additionally, employing secure Wi-Fi networks and isolating your smart devices on separate networks can prevent unauthorized access. Neglecting security considerations can lead to breaches that compromise your privacy and safety.
Despite these challenges, the good news is that many protocols are designed with interoperability and security in mind. Standards like Thread and Zigbee 3.0 aim to unify device communication, making it easier for various brands to work together efficiently. Smart hubs and platforms like Apple HomeKit, Google Home, and Amazon Alexa act as central points that translate and coordinate between different protocols, easing compatibility issues. They also often come with security features that help safeguard your data. How Do Protocols Ensure Device Security and Privacy?
Protocols guarantee your device security and privacy through device authentication, verifying each device’s identity before communication. They also use data encryption to protect your data from eavesdropping or tampering. When these measures are in place, it becomes harder for hackers to access your smart home system. By combining device authentication and encryption, protocols create a secure environment, keeping your personal information safe and your devices protected from unauthorized access.
Can Different Brands’ Devices Communicate Seamlessly?
Imagine you’re in a sci-fi movie, where gadgets from different brands seamlessly communicate. In reality, brand compatibility and cross-platform integration make this possible. Many protocols, like Zigbee and Z-Wave, enable devices from various brands to work together, but their success depends on compatible standards. While some integrations are smooth, others may need a hub or bridge, so check device compatibility to guarantee your smart home functions flawlessly across brands.
What Are the Common Challenges in Integrating Multiple Protocols?
Integrating multiple protocols often faces challenges with protocol compatibility and device interoperability. You might find that some devices don’t communicate smoothly because they use different standards or lack universal compatibility. To overcome this, you need hubs or bridges that translate signals between protocols. Ensuring that your devices support common standards and investing in compatible hubs can help you create a cohesive smart home system, minimizing connectivity issues.
How Do Protocols Handle Network Congestion or Interference?
Protocols handle network congestion and interference through frequency management and interference mitigation. They actively monitor channel usage, switching frequencies when interference spikes, and prioritize critical data to reduce delays. By coordinating devices to avoid crowded channels and employing error correction techniques, protocols create a smoother, more reliable network. This ongoing dance of adjusting frequencies and alleviating interference ensures your smart home stays responsive, even amid crowded wireless environments.
